Las Tablas, located in the Los Santos province of Panama, serves as a strategic logistics hub for the Azuero Peninsula region. The area benefits from Panama's position as a global logistics center, with proximity to the Panama Canal and major port facilities. Las Tablas's economy includes agricultural production, particularly in rice and livestock, as well as growing manufacturing and export-oriented industries. The region's transportation infrastructure includes access to the Pan-American Highway and connections to Panama's extensive road network, facilitating efficient movement of goods to major ports and border crossings.

Providence, Rhode Island stands as a strategic logistics center in the northeastern United States, offering exceptional connectivity to major markets along the East Coast. The city's location provides access to I-95, one of the nation's busiest freight corridors, connecting to Boston, New York, and beyond. Providence's economy encompasses advanced manufacturing, healthcare, education, and a robust distribution sector. The region benefits from multiple transportation options including the Port of Providence, TF Green International Airport, and an extensive rail network, making it an ideal destination for efficient cargo distribution throughout the northeastern United States.
